Interaction Details
Oxazepam is classified as belonging to the following category: Glucuronidated Drugs
Theoretically, lemongrass might increase the clearance and decrease the levels of glucuronidated drugs.
Animal research shows that lemongrass and its constituent citral induce uridine diphosphoglucuronosyl transferase (UGT), the major phase 2 enzyme that is responsible for glucuronidation.

Oxazepam Overview
-
Oxazepam is used to relieve anxiety, including anxiety caused by alcohol withdrawal (symptoms that may develop in people who stop drinking alcohol after drinking large amounts for a long time). Oxazepam is in a class of medications called benzodiazepines. It works by slowing activity in the brain to allow for relaxation.
